Section 9: Manner of apportioning rent on termination of tenancy in respect of part of land leased

The Goa, Daman and Diu Agricultural Tenancy Rules, 1965.State Rules of Goa · 1964

(1) For the purposes of sub-section (9) of section 20, the rent for the area remaining with the tenant shall be determined in the following manner.

(a) The rent shall be calculated at the rate fixed by the Mamlatdar, under section 24 for the village or group of villages or area in which the land is situated for the class of land to which such area belongs.

(b) If the Mamlatdar has not fixed the rate of rent under section 24 and the landlord and tenant do not agree as to the amount of the rent to be paid for such area, the landlord shall make an application in Form V to the Mamlatdar for apportionment of the rent.

(2) On receipt of an application under sub-rule (1) (b) the Mamlatdar shall give a -4- notice to the tenant and after holding an enquiry fix the rent of the area of the land left with the tenant after taking into consideration the following factors-viz.

a) The total area and kind of the land held by a tenant before the termination of his tenancy of a part of such land and the rent paid by him therefore;

(b) The profits of agriculture of the similar lands in the locality;

(d) The improvements made in the land by the tenant or the landlord.
